Which of the following is an example of a detective control?
A.
Automatic shut-off valve.
B.
Auto-correct software functionality.
C.
Confirmation with suppliers and vendors.
D.
Safety instructions.
The Answer Is:
C
This question includes an explanation.
Explanation:
An example of a detective control is confirmation with suppliers and vendors. This control involves verifying transactions after they occur to ensure accuracy and authenticity, helping to detect errors or fraud in the organization's operations with external parties.
